What to Expect During a Professional AC Repair Service Visit
When your air conditioner stops cooling properly, starts making strange noises, or begins biking on and off on the wrong times, scheduling a professional AC repair service visit is usually the smartest subsequent step. Many homeowners know they need assistance, but they are not always certain what actually occurs when a technician arrives. Understanding the process can make the appointment less nerve-racking and assist you to really feel more assured in regards to the service you receive.
A professional AC repair visit often begins earlier than the technician even steps through the door. Most reputable HVAC companies will confirm your appointment time, ask in regards to the signs your system is showing, and will request a number of particulars in regards to the age or model of your unit. This information helps the technician arrive better prepared with the appropriate tools and customary replacement parts.
Once the technician arrives, the primary part of the visit is typically an initial conversation. They will ask what points you might have observed, corresponding to weak airflow, warm air coming from the vents, unusual odors, rising energy bills, or water leaking across the indoor unit. The more clearly you describe the problem, the better it is for the technician to slender down attainable causes. You might also be asked when the problem started and whether or not it occurs all the time or only throughout sure parts of the day.
After gathering particulars, the technician will move on to a full inspection of your AC system. This usually includes checking both the indoor and outside components. Inside the home, they could inspect the thermostat, air handler, evaporator coil, condensate drain line, air filter, blower motor, and electrical connections. Outside, they often examine the condenser unit, compressor, fan motor, refrigerant lines, and capacitor. A professional technician is not just looking for one obvious problem. They are also checking for related points that might affect performance or lead to future breakdowns.
Through the diagnostic stage, the technician may use specialised tools to test voltage, amperage, refrigerant pressure, airflow, and temperature differences. These readings assist determine whether the problem is electrical, mechanical, or associated to airflow and refrigerant levels. In lots of cases, what appears like a major air conditioning failure may actually come down to a clogged filter, a defective capacitor, a dirty coil, or a malfunctioning thermostat. Alternatively, deeper issues like compressor hassle or refrigerant leaks could require more in depth repair.
One thing homeowners admire throughout a professional AC repair service visit is transparency. A great technician will clarify what they’re discovering in easy language rather than overwhelming you with technical jargon. They should walk you through the issue, clarify why it is going on, and outline the available repair options. If replacement parts are needed, they will often focus on the cost of the part, labor expenses, and whether or not the repair can be completed instantly or requires a observe-up visit.
In many service calls, the repair may be accomplished on the same day. Technicians typically carry commonly wanted parts similar to capacitors, contactors, fuses, relays, and certain motors. If the problem is comparatively straightforward, the system may be repaired and tested during that first appointment. Once the repair is completed, the technician will typically run the AC unit again to confirm that it is cooling correctly, cycling properly, and operating safely.
If the repair is more complex, the visit may still be highly valuable because it provides a transparent diagnosis and a repair plan. For instance, in case your system has a refrigerant leak, damaged coil, or failing compressor, the technician might have to order a selected part or schedule additional time for the repair. In these cases, the visit helps you understand the condition of your system and what steps are wanted next.
One other necessary part of a professional AC repair service visit is identifying maintenance points that will have contributed to the problem. The technician could point out dirty coils, blocked vents, uncared for filters, or signs of wear which have developed over time. Even if those items aren’t the direct cause of the present subject, addressing them can improve system effectivity and stop additional repairs in the future. This kind of knowledgeable feedback is likely one of the major benefits of hiring a professional professional instead of trying to guess what is wrong in your own.
Homeowners also needs to anticipate a concentrate on safety through the appointment. Air conditioning systems contain electricity, pressurized refrigerant, and sensitive equipment that must be handled properly. A licensed technician knows find out how to inspect these parts safely and comply with proper procedures when repairing or testing the unit. This reduces the risk of further damage to the system and helps protect your home.
Earlier than the visit ends, the technician will normally summarize the work performed and clarify the results. If the system is fixed, they might supply ideas for keeping it running smoothly, corresponding to changing the filter recurrently, keeping the outdoor unit clear of debris, and scheduling routine maintenance. If additional work is required, they should explain the following steps and give you a realistic understanding of timing and costs.
Making ready for the appointment may help the visit go more smoothly. Make certain there is clear access to the indoor unit, thermostat, and outside condenser. Keep pets secured, and write down any points you could have observed so you’ll be able to describe them clearly. If in case you have earlier service records or warranty information, having these available will also be helpful.
Knowing what to anticipate during a professional AC repair service visit can take much of the uncertainty out of the process. From inspection and diagnostics to repair recommendations and system testing, the goal is to restore your comfort as quickly and efficiently as possible. A professional visit is not just about fixing what is broken. Additionally it is about making certain your air conditioning system runs safely, reliably, and efficiently when you want it most.

Why Fast AC Repair Service Can Save You Money on Energy Bills
A struggling air conditioner can do more than make your home feel uncomfortable. It could possibly also send your energy bills higher month after month. Many homeowners ignore small warning signs, hoping the issue will go away on its own. In reality, delaying repairs usually offers a minor problem time to turn out to be more expensive.
Fast AC repair service is just not only about restoring cool air quickly. It is usually one of the smartest ways to protect your budget. When your system runs efficiently, it uses less electricity, cools your home faster, and avoids the extra strain that leads to larger repair costs. Understanding how quick service helps can make a big difference in both comfort and long-term savings.
An Inefficient AC System Makes use of More Power
When an air conditioner is working properly, it cycles on and off on the right occasions and keeps indoor temperatures steady. When something starts to fail, the system has to work harder to produce the same results. This extra effort increases energy use.
A clogged filter, refrigerant leak, worn motor, faulty thermostat, or dirty coils can all reduce efficiency. Even a small concern can cause the unit to run longer than necessary. The longer it runs, the more electricity it consumes. That added power usage shows up directly on your month-to-month utility bill.
Fast AC repair service helps catch these problems before they force the system to waste energy each day. A technician can identify the source of the inefficiency and proper it earlier than it continues driving costs higher.
Small Problems Typically Turn Into Bigger Expenses
One of many biggest reasons homeowners overspend on cooling is waiting too long to call for help. A minor challenge may seem manageable at first, especially if the AC is still producing some cool air. Nonetheless, damaged parts not often improve on their own.
For instance, a weak capacitor can put further strain on the compressor. A dirty evaporator coil can reduce airflow and make the blower work harder. Low refrigerant levels can cause all the system to run longer while delivering less cooling. If these issues are ignored, they will lead to major component failure.
Fast repairs reduce the risk of a chain response inside the system. Replacing a small part early is usually far cheaper than paying for a major breakdown later. You additionally avoid the high energy costs that come from running an underperforming unit for weeks or months.
Higher Airflow Means Lower Utility Costs
Poor airflow is likely one of the most common reasons an AC system becomes inefficient. If cooled air can’t move properly through the home, the system has to keep working to reach the desired temperature. This means more wear on elements and more cash spent on electricity.
Fast AC repair service can restore proper airflow by addressing blockages, duct issues, dirty coils, frozen parts, or fan problems. Once airflow improves, the system can cool the space more successfully in less time.
That effectivity matters throughout hot weather when the AC is already under heavy demand. A unit that cools your home quickly and evenly will use far less energy than one which runs always but struggles to keep up.
A Properly Repaired AC Prevents Overcooling
When an air conditioner isn’t functioning appropriately, homeowners typically respond by lowering the thermostat further. This is a typical reaction when rooms still feel warm or inconsistently cooled. The result’s a system that works even harder and consumes even more energy.
The real problem may not be the thermostat setting at all. It might be a failing part preventing the system from doing its job efficiently. Fast AC repair service solves the precise issue instead of forcing the system to compensate through longer run instances and lower settings.
As soon as the unit is repaired, it can keep the target temperature without needing fixed adjustments. That helps control energy use and keeps bills from rising unnecessarily.
Quick Repairs Assist Extend System Lifespan
An overworked air conditioner doesn’t just cost more to run. It additionally wears out faster. Each extra hour of operation adds stress to motors, fans, compressors, and electrical components. If the system is forced to run in poor condition for too long, it might reach the end of its lifespan a lot ahead of expected.
Changing a whole AC unit is way more expensive than repairing one at the right time. Fast service helps protect the health of the system by stopping unnecessary strain early. This can delay the necessity for replacement and protect your investment for years.
A longer-lasting unit also means more value from earlier upkeep and set up costs. In that way, well timed repair creates financial savings beyond just the month-to-month electric bill.
Emergency Repairs Can Be More Costly Than Prompt Service
Waiting until the system utterly stops working can create one other monetary burden. Emergency repairs during peak summer season months are sometimes more disturbing and typically more expensive than scheduled service when the primary warning signs appear.
An AC that quits throughout excessive heat might leave you with limited options. It’s possible you’ll need rapid help, temporary cooling solutions, or even a rushed replacement if the damage is severe. Fast AC repair service reduces the prospect of dealing with those high-pressure situations.
By acting early, you keep in control of the problem and might usually resolve it at a a lot lower cost.
Signs You Should Not Ignore
Saving cash on energy bills starts with paying attention to how your system behaves. When you discover warm air, weak airflow, unusual noises, strange odors, rising utility bills, or short biking, those are strong signs that your AC needs attention.
Even if the unit still turns on, these signs often point to growing problems that harm efficiency. Calling for fast AC repair service as quickly as these warning signs seem can stop energy waste earlier than it becomes a long-term expense.
Fast AC Repair Is a Smart Financial Choice
Many homeowners think delaying repairs saves money, but the opposite is often true. A damaged or inefficient air conditioner makes use of more energy, struggles to cool properly, and puts important parts at risk. All of that leads to higher energy bills and larger repair costs over time.
Fast AC repair service helps your system operate the way it should. It restores efficiency, reduces wasted electricity, improves comfort, and lowers the possibility of serious breakdowns. For homeowners who want better performance and lower monthly costs, performing quickly is one of the smartest decisions they can make.
